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
843800226 741 68608369 34369 7680484
302 3279
302 3279
56249390 811269395 364234 86779557
All about undefined
Interested in learning more?
302 3279
56249390 811269395 364234 86779557
See more
592893487 340853 35
44 51 839690718
See more
022605886 380125 780104
7761400 181 309
See more